Akron Main Campus Application and Admission Information
For the academic year 2022-23, the acceptance rate is 82.87% at University of Akron Main Campus. Total 12,282 students applied and 10,178 were accepted. The average SAT score of enrolled students is 1,090 and the average ACT score is 22.

Acceptance Rate, Yield, and Headcounts
For the academic year 2022-2023, the acceptance rate is 82.87%. A total of 12,282 students (5,771 men and 6,511 women) have applied to and 10,178 (4,747 men and 5,431 women) students admitted
to University of Akron Main Campus.
Among them, 1,125 male and 990 female students have enrolled into Akron Main Campus and its yield, also known as enrollment rate is 20.78%. The following table shows the admission statistics including admission stats, acceptance rate, and yield.
Total | Men | Women | Another Gender | Gender Unknown |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Applicants | 12,282 | 5,771 | 6,511 | 0 | 0 |
Admitted | 10,178 | 4,747 | 5,431 | 0 | 0 |
Enrolled | 2,115 | 1,125 | 990 | 0 | 0 |
Acceptance Rate | 82.87% | 82.26% | 83.41% | - | - |
Yield (Enrollment Rate) | 20.78% | 23.70% | 18.23% | - | - |
Average SAT and ACT Scores
At Akron Main Campus, 374 applicants (18% of enrolled) have submitted their SAT scores and 1,623 applicants (77%) have submitted their ACT scores for seeking degrees.
The average SAT score of those who submitted scores is 1,090 at Akron Main Campus. SAT 75th percentile score is 1,230 and 25th percentile score is 980.
The average ACT score is 22 (ACT Composite) . The 75th percentile score of ACT is 25 and the 25th percentile score is 18.

Application Requirements
For applying to University of Akron Main Campus, applicants require to submit 3 item(s) - High School GPA, Completion of College Preparatory Program, English Proficiency Test.
In addition, 5 item(s) are considered for admission - High School Record, Recommendations, Formal Demonstration of Competencies, Admission Test Scores, Personal statement or essay.
